Technical Specifications

Molecular FormulaC14H12Cl2N4O
Molecular Weight322.03882 g/mol
XLogP3.3
Topological Polar Surface Area (TPSA)70.1 Ų
Hydrogen Bond Donors2
Hydrogen Bond Acceptors3
Rotatable Bonds4
Exact Mass322.03882 Da
Heavy Atoms21
Complexity406.0
SMILESC1CC1C2=CC(=NN2)C(=O)N/N=C/C3=C(C=CC=C3Cl)Cl
InChIKeyHFIDBJVCQWUOKX-REZTVBANSA-N

Property Insights of UPCMLD0ENAT5755235:001

The XLogP value of 3.3 indicates that UPCMLD0ENAT5755235:001 is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. The TPSA of 70.1 Ų falls within the moderate polarity range, balancing permeability and solubility for UPCMLD0ENAT5755235:001. Following Lipinski's Rule of Five, UPCMLD0ENAT5755235:001 has 2 hydrogen bond donor(s) and 3 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
